$14,000 at most.
Unless a car is completely stock and very low mileage or completely built and in beautiful shape.....Blue Book/NADA value plus a couple thousand is about the going rate now. I gave this car a "fair" value on the KBB system because there is no doubt some mechanical issues somewhere as well as some blemishes (I'd call that hideous front and wheels a blemish!!). With that KBB says Private party should be $9985 (With a "good" rating still is only $10,930). So, almost $4-5000 over that sounds right.
